5LDI
Crystal structure of E.coli LigT in apo form
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| PETRA III, DESY BEAMLINE P11 |
Synchrotron site | PETRA III, DESY |
Beamline | P11 |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2013-05-18 |
Detector | DECTRIS PILATUS 6M-F |
Wavelength(s) | 1.033 |
Spacegroup name | P 1 21 1 |
Unit cell lengths | 63.390, 88.320, 73.840 |
Unit cell angles | 90.00, 115.01, 90.00 |
Refinement procedure
Resolution | 36.604 - 2.100 |
R-factor | 0.1799 |
Rwork | 0.177 |
R-free | 0.22670 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| PDBid:1iuh |
RMSD bond length | 0.004 |
RMSD bond angle | 0.981 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| PHASER |
Refinement software | PHENIX (1.9_1692)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 50.000 | 2.150 |
High resolution limit [Å] | 2.100 | 2.100 |
Rmerge | 0.076 | 0.918 |
Number of reflections | 43063 | |
<I/σ(I)> | 11.93 | 1.3 |
Completeness [%] | 99.6 | 99.8 |
Redundancy | 3.81 | 3.83 |
CC(1/2) | 0.998 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 7.5 | 293 | 0.1 M Tris-HCl pH 7.5, 0.2 M MgCl2, 14% (w/v) PEG 8000 |
